Cognitive biases, huh? Theyre like those sneaky little gremlins messing with your brain, especially when youre trying to make smart security choices.
Like, take availability heuristic. Aint nobody gonna be worried about some rare cyberattack if all they hear about is phishing! The most readily available information, thats what sticks, even if its not the biggest actual threat.
Then theres confirmation bias. We aint exactly unbiased creatures. We look for evidence that backs up what we already believe. Think someones lying? Youll probably only see the shifty eyes and stammering, not the perfectly normal stuff. So, if a user already thinks their password is "good enough", they aint gonna listen to any security advice, are they?
And dont even get me started on optimism bias! "It wont happen to me," right? managed service new york Folks think theyre somehow immune to risks that plague everyone else. This aint good when it comes to clicking shady links or sharing too much online.
These biases arent just theoretical. Theyre impacting real security decisions every single day. Its a shame, really. We need to be aware of these mental hiccups, so we dont become easy prey. Its not easy, but understanding these biases is a crucial step in building a more secure world.
Security Psychology: Social Engineering Tactics and Vulnerabilities
Yikes, security psychology, huh? Its not just about firewalls and encryption, no siree!
Think about it. Phishing isnt just some technical exploit, is it? It plays on fear, greed, and a lack of attention. A convincing email, maybe claiming urgent action is needed on your bank account, can bypass even the most sophisticated antivirus software. Heck, who hasnt almost fallen for one? Its not always easy to spot the deception, is it?
Then theres pretexting. This is where the attacker crafts a believable scenario, a "pretext," to trick you into divulging information. They might pose as tech support, a contractor, or even someone from HR. The key is theyre not who they say they are. Its disturbing how many folks will just hand over sensitive data cause someone sounds official.
And what about baiting? Offering something enticing – a free download, a gift card – laced with malware. It preys on our desire for a good deal. Who doesnt enjoy a freebie? But trust me, that "free" software isnt worth it.
Vulnerabilities? Oh boy, there are plenty. Lack of awareness is huge. People simply arent educated enough about these tactics. And then theres cognitive biases – those mental shortcuts that can lead us astray. We tend to trust authority figures, we like to reciprocate favors, and we often assume things are safe until proven otherwise. These biases are like open doors for social engineers. Its not that everyone is stupid, its just that these tactics are really good at exploiting our weaknesses.
Ultimately, combating social engineering isnt just about technical solutions, is it? Its about education, training, and fostering a culture of security awareness. We gotta be vigilant, question everything, and remember, if something seems too good to be true, it probably is. Otherwise, were just sitting ducks, arent we?

Security Psychology: The Gut Feeling of a Secure User
Security isnt just about firewalls and complex passwords, yknow? Its deeply intertwined with how we feel. Think about it, we aint robots, are we? Emotions, for better or worse, play a huge, often underestimated, role in our security behaviors. It aint just logic driving our decisions, oh no.
Fear, for example, can be a powerful motivator. If youre truly scared of getting hacked, youre probably more likely to use a longer, more complex password and be wary of suspicious links. But it aint always that simple. Too much fear? Paralyzing! Folks might just give up, thinking "Whats the point? Im gonna get hacked anyway!" Thats not good, is it?
Then you got apathy. If someone dont care about security, because they dont believe theyre a target, theyre gonna ignore warnings and cut corners. "It wont happen to me," they say. Famous last words! managed it security services provider This is often due to a lack of perceived risk. Theyre just not feeling the threat, and therefore, they arent acting securely.
And dont forget about trust. Were more likely to click a link from a friend, even if it looks a little iffy, because we trust them. But what if their accounts been compromised? Ouch! Our emotional connection blinds us to potential dangers.
Frustration also plays a part. If security measures are too cumbersome, people will find ways around them. Aint nobody got time for that! They might disable multi-factor authentication, or reuse passwords, just to make things easier. The emotional cost of security outweighs the perceived risk, and thats a problem.
So, understanding these emotional drivers is crucial for creating effective security strategies. Its not enough to just tell people what to do; we gotta tap into their emotions, address their fears, and make security feel less like a burden and more like a natural, positive thing. We cant ignore this human element. Its all about designing systems that work with our feelings, not against them. Gee, thatd be something, wouldnt it?
